Laboratory Automated Interrogation of Data: an interactive web application for visualization of multilevel data from biological experiments
Published in Brain Communications, 2024
A key step in understanding the results of biological experiments is visualization of the data. Many laboratory experiments contain a range of measurements that exist within a hierarchy of interdependence. An automated and facile way to visualize and interrogate such multilevel data, across many experimental variables, would:
- lead to improved understanding of the results,
- help to avoid misleading interpretation of statistics, and
- easily identify outliers and sources of batch and confounding effects.
While many excellent graphing solutions already exist, they are often geared towards the production of publication-ready plots and the analysis of a single variable at a time, require programming expertise or are unnecessarily complex for the task at hand. Here, we present Laboratory Automated Interrogation of Data (LAB-AID), an interactive tool specifically designed to automatically visualize and query hierarchical data resulting from biological experiments.
